The CHANGE WIDTH END command lets you change the width at a single span’s endpoint. A span can have different widths at each node, enabling you to create networks with a taper. The end width is the length measured at the endpoint, perpendicular to the direction of the span.
To change the end width of an existing span, select [Draw > Walls > Chg Wid End] from the menu:
The prompt reads "New Network Width:". Type in a new width in drawing units and press ENTER; or specify a distance on the screen using the mouse.
The prompt reads "Network to modify:". Using the pick box, select the specific span near the endpoint you wish to modify.
CC3 immediately redraws the network, re-specifying the end width of the targeted span.
The prompt still reads "Network to modify:". Using the pick box, you can continue to select spans, modifying their chosen endpoint widths. Or to finish, right-click and select Done from the Networks popup menu .
Text equivalent: NETWIDE
